In the past few years, scientific studies have indicated that it can help with a spectrum of health concerns. These include anxiety, Alzheimer’s disease, addiction, arthritis, inflammatory bowel disease, fractures, migraines, psoriasis, and pain.
From anecdotal evidence in people and from animal studies, CBD appears to influence the way we experience pain, inflammation, and anxiety.
Scientists have identified a number of receptors in the nervous system where CBD acts and it has been proven that CBD has anti-inflammatory properties and can increase activity at some serotonin receptors.

Kudla is a locality in the northern Adelaide suburbs, 34 km from the city centre, just south of Gawler. It is in the Town of Gawler local government area.
Kudla is bounded by Main North Road, Dalkeith Road, Angle Vale Road and Gordon Road. Coventry Road is the most significant road through the area, approximately southwest to northeast. Kudla is named after the Kudla railway station, which in turn had been named from an Aboriginal word meaning level ground, open or remote. The name was approved in 1982 in preference to alternate possibilities of Dalkeith and Dalkeith Vale. Kudla is served by the Dalkeith Country Fire Service based on the south side of the Dalkeith Road and Coventry Road intersection.
Kudla is served by the Kudla railway station on the Gawler railway line and is west of Main North Road.
